[[folder:Clarice]]
* AdaptationalPersonalityChange: Clarice's personality in ''Chip 'n' Dale: Park Life'' is stern, serious, and tomboyish. Compared to her standard personality where she's flirtatious, bubbly, and sweet-natured. She also has shades of a CompositeCharacter, given how she's a skilled mechanic and tinkerer, just like the chipmunks' mutual love interest in ''WesternAnimation/ChipNDaleRescueRangers''.
* AnthropomorphicShift: A reverse example with Clarice who's depicted as a regular chipmunk as Chip and Dale in the series. Compared to her standard design where she had a more humanoid design.
* TheBusCameBack: [[WesternAnimation/TwoChipsAndAMiss Clarice the Chipmunk]] from the 1952 ''WesternAnimation/ChipAndDale'' short [[WesternAnimation/ClassicDisneyShorts "Two Chips And A Miss"]] also returned after being absent in animation for 69 years (not counting some of Disney's Japanese exclusive shorts).
* CompositeCharacter: As stated above in AdaptationalPersonalityChange, Clarice seems to be this with Gadget Hackwrench from ''WesternAnimation/ChipNDaleRescueRangers''.
* YouDontLookLikeYou: Clarice looks very different from her first appearance in ''WesternAnimation/TwoChipsAndAMiss'', in fact combined with her AnthropomorphicShift; as stated above, and her new tomboyish personality many would be surprised to discover she's well a '''she'''.
[[/folder]]

[[folder:Pluto]]
* AdaptationalNiceGuy: Most cartoons have Pluto be actively hostile toward Chip and Dale. Here, he gets along with them so long as they aren't being harsh to him. In other words, the times when he is hostile toward them in this show is actually justified.
* HelpImStuck: In "Dog in the House", Pluto gets stuck inside of Chip and Dale's home after he chases Chip in there, and he is unable to get out afterward until the end.
